Have you ever wondered why God chose a garden as the first home of humanity?

I have.

And really … I’ve asked myself, why NOT a mansion? Why NOT an adorable cottage? Why NOT a tall extravagant building … Or a Cathedral where the morning and evening light is captured by stain glass art?

He’s capable of creating ANYTHING … so why a garden?

We will never know what that first garden looked like. And maybe, that’s good, because then we’re invited into a conversation. Or even into our imaginations.

It makes me curious. What’s so special about a garden? What did it provide for humanity that God knew we needed?

Maybe it’s because a garden provides:

Sanctuary.

Beauty.

Food.

Conversation.

Deep intimate connection.

Purpose.

Peace.

Rest.

God asked Adam and Eve to be part of the tending and keeping. He invited them to be a part of the creative process. He said, come … be a gardener with me.

He invited them to:

Walk.

Look.

Touch.

Taste.

See.

Drink.

Plant.

Savor.

A God who needs no one and needs nothing says, I want you to be with Me … to create with Me.

Yes, yes. I know how the rest of the story goes. But I want to sit in these moments in the story … in the garden before all things are broken.

It’s like He’s saying, I want you to experience me as God but I also want you to experience me as friend.

He’s always ever wanted to be connected to our hearts. Maybe it’s the best place for us to see Him more fully but also where we get to be seen by Him, known by Him, loved by Him …

You may not have a plant garden to tend to, but our hearts are like gardens, our families are like gardens, our marriages are like gardens, our friendships are like gardens, our homes are like gardens …
